Uyuni Salt Lake! Fantastic and Beautiful Reflection on The Surface of The Water Chichibugahama Beach
The gradation of the sky that is clearly reflected on the mirror-like surface of the water. Selected as one of Japan's top 100 sunsets, be sure to capture the ever-changing beautiful sunset with your camera! The point is to release the shutter when the water surface is not rippling and there is no wind.

Flower Park Urashima, located at Mitoyo City which has the biggest production of marguerite in Japan, is a scenic spot you can enjoy both flowers and Seto Inland Sea. This year, I found the lovely heart shape made of pink marguerite flowers.◎Free parking area is available. No entrance fee. The best season to see is from the beginning of May to the the middle of May.

Mt.Shiude is a popular spot for the whole view of Setouchi. In spring, it gets crowded most in a year. Along the slopes of the mountain, numberless cherry trees are in full bloom proudly. And with the panorama of Setouchi, I want to burn the scenery into my eyes!◎A traffic jam is caused for parking lots around the mountain top. Early in the morning could be better. ※Some people climb up on foot from the bottom.

2000 cherry trees are the largest scale in Shikoku. They are planted to spread over the bridge and the roads, and from the observatory you can see the sea and mountains making a beautiful contrast. Here is the best spot of cherry blossom trees designed on purpose to be a picturesque scenery.

Mampuku-ji is famous as a wisteria temple in Kagawa Prefecture. The wisteria trellis with some kinds, white and purple, spreads the length of the precinct, which is worth seeing. I could enjoy the bright spring scenery from the bench under the roof of wisteria.◎Best season to see starts from the end of April to the beginning of May. In 2018, they're in its best on 4/22.

Nio Dragon Festival' is hold to pray for rain in Mitoyo city, Kagawa Prefecture. A huge dragon made of straw and bamboo , which is as ling as 35m and weights 2t, is carried by 200 people. Then, the other people with buckets and water guns throw water from the both sides of the street. It's an exciting summer festival.◎Date & Time: 8/5, water throwing is 20:00~. You need to wear you can get wet and bring buckets, water guns and so on. There're some food strolls.

Fudo Waterfall in Mitoyo City is one of the 100 Best Scenery In Kagawa, and you can enjoy cherry blossom in spring and fall foliage in autumn. It's located between Shippou Mountain that had a connection with Kobo Daishi (a great priest), so you can feel relaxed to see the water falls and autumn leaves together in this area with rich nature.◎Free parking lot is available. 20 min drive from Sanuki Toyonaka IC of Takamatsu Speed Way.

Missing Post Office receive the letters written for yourselves in the future or someone you can't see any more. It's one of the art project, and exhibits the letters without addresses to be read by someone you don't know.◎5min walk from a port. It was used as a real post office. You can send a letter with no address and read exhibited letters here.

Togawa Dam Park is selected as one of the 100 best scenery in Kagawa Prefecture. In spring, the cherry blossoms make a stunning view of pink forest. And the esplanades are equipped, you can walk under the cherry blossom tunnel!◎Best season of cherry blossoms is from the end of March to the beginning of April. They have illumination event, too. A Road Station 'Takarada-no Sato Saita' and onsen facility are also inside the park.

It's a Japan's first school for sailor (closed in1987). A nostalgic pale green building is now a memorial hall with exhibitions such as ship models.◎No entrance fee. 3min walk from a port and it's a symbol of Awashima.
